解决GitHub Markdown图片不显示问题的全面指南

在使用GitHub的Markdown时,许多用户会遇到图片无法显示的问题。这不仅影响文档的美观性,还可能导致信息传递不完整。本文将探讨导致这种情况的原因,并提供多种解决方案,帮助用户顺利解决GitHub Markdown中的图片不显示问题。

目录

什么是Markdown?

Markdown 是一种轻量级的标记语言,旨在让书写文档变得简单。它可以通过一些简单的符号来格式化文本,并广泛用于编写文档、README文件和在线内容。GitHub作为一个热门的代码托管平台,自然支持Markdown,使得开发者可以更方便地编写项目文档。

GitHub上的Markdown支持

在GitHub中,用户可以使用Markdown格式来编写项目文档,说明文件,以及提交信息等。GitHub支持的Markdown包括:

  • 基本语法:标题、列表、粗体、斜体等。
  • 链接和图片插入:通过特定的语法来添加链接和图片。

图片不显示的常见原因

在GitHub上使用Markdown时,图片不显示的原因可能包括:

  • 路径错误:图片的URL地址不正确。
  • 图片格式不支持:GitHub支持的图片格式有限,通常是PNG、JPG、GIF等。
  • 权限设置问题:若图片托管在私有仓库或其他有权限限制的地方,可能导致无法显示。
  • 图片未上传:确保所引用的图片已成功上传到GitHub。

如何正确插入图片

在Markdown中插入图片的基本语法如下:

markdown 替代文本

  • 替代文本:在图片未显示时所显示的文本。
  • 图片URL:图片的完整地址,可以是相对路径或绝对路径。

示例

markdown 示例图片

解决图片不显示问题的具体方法

为了帮助用户解决图片不显示的问题,可以采取以下方法:

1. 检查图片路径

确保所插入的图片路径是正确的。对于相对路径,确保图片在同一仓库下并且路径无误。

2. 上传图片至GitHub

确保图片已经上传至GitHub。在issuespull requests中上传的图片会生成相应的链接。

3. 使用原始链接

对于在GitHub上托管的图片,确保使用原始链接。在查看图片时,可以右击选择“在新标签页中打开”,获取原始链接。

4. 检查图片格式

确保图片格式是GitHub所支持的。常见的支持格式包括PNG、JPG、GIF等。

5. 权限设置

如果图片位于私有仓库中,请确保已授予必要的权限,否则将无法显示。

6. 使用图床

可以使用第三方图床(如Imgur)来上传图片,确保获得有效的链接。

常见问题解答

1. GitHub Markdown中可以使用哪些图片格式?

GitHub Markdown支持的图片格式包括PNG、JPG、GIF等常见格式。确保图片为这些格式之一。

2. 如何确认我的图片路径正确?

可以在GitHub上直接点击图片,查看链接是否有效。如果链接在新标签页中能正常打开,则路径正确。

3. 为什么我的私有仓库中的图片无法显示?

由于权限限制,私有仓库中的图片只能由有权限的用户访问。如果没有合适的权限,图片将无法显示。

4. 如果我在Markdown中插入图片后依然不显示,我应该怎么办?

首先检查图片路径、格式及权限设置。如果都正确,尝试重新上传图片或使用其他的图床服务。

5. 如何使用图床服务来解决图片不显示的问题?

可以将图片上传到像Imgur这样的图床服务,并获取原始链接,然后在Markdown中插入该链接。

总结

在GitHub使用Markdown时,图片不显示的问题虽然常见,但通过合理的路径设置、权限管理和格式检查,用户可以轻松解决。希望本文能帮助您更顺利地使用GitHub Markdown,展示您的项目和内容。

正文完